What are the main differences between OSHA 10 and OSHA 30 certifications?

The main differences between OSHA 10 and OSHA 30 certifications revolve around their target audience, course length, depth of content, and specific training focus. Here’s a detailed comparison:

Target Audience

  • OSHA 10: Designed for entry-level workers who need a basic understanding of workplace safety. It is suitable for employees responsible primarily for their own safety.
  • OSHA 30: Aimed at supervisors, managers, and safety professionals who have responsibilities for overseeing the safety of others. This course is ideal for those in leadership roles.

Course Length

  • OSHA 10: Consists of 10 hours of training, typically spread over two days.
  • OSHA 30: Comprises 30 hours of training, usually conducted over four days.

Depth of Content

  • OSHA 10: Covers fundamental safety topics including:
    • Introduction to OSHA standards
    • Basic safety protocols
    • Fall protection
    • Electrical safety
    • Personal protective equipment (PPE)
  • OSHA 30: Includes all topics from the OSHA 10 course but goes into greater detail and covers additional advanced topics such as:
    • Advanced safety management
    • Hearing conservation
    • Respiratory protection
    • Lead and silica safety
    • Fire safety protocols
    • Ergonomics principles

Specific Training Focus

  • OSHA 10: Focuses on general awareness and basic safety practices relevant to various industries.
  • OSHA 30: Provides comprehensive training on managing workplace safety and health risks, making it more suitable for those who will implement and oversee safety programs.

Prerequisites

  • There is no requirement to complete the OSHA 10 course before taking the OSHA 30 course; individuals can choose either based on their roles and responsibilities.

These distinctions highlight the importance of selecting the appropriate course based on your job requirements and career goals.
